Telegram Bot Developer (TypeScript, ethers.js, grammy)
Job Description:
We are working to create a simple buy and sell Telegram bot to allow users to swap erc20 tokens on the Ethereum network. It may be expanded into a sniper bot. A large portion of the code base has already been completed.
We are seeking a skilled developer with experience in TypeScript, ethers.js, and hardhat to join our team. The ideal candidate will have a strong understanding of Ethereum and experience working with ethers.js. Please include a resume and link to examples of previous work in your application.
Responsibilities:
•Write clean, readable, and testable code for a Telegram bot using TypeScript, ethers.js, and the grammy framework
•Work with two existing code bases for reference and guidance on what needs to be done
•Collaborate with the myself and others to design, develop, and maintain the bot
•Ensure the bot is reliable, performant, and scalable
•Write unit and integration tests for the bot
Requirements:
•3+ years of experience in software development
•Experience with Typescript, ethers.js, hardhat, and relational databases
•Strong understanding of Ethereum and its ecosystem
•Experience building and maintaining scalable and reliable applications
•Strong problem-solving skills and ability to work independently
•Excellent English communication and collaboration skills
•Include the word "pineapple" in your application so I know you have read the job description
Nice-to-have:
•Experience with Telegram bots and the Grammy framework
•Familiarity with other blockchain platforms and frameworks
Important note: I am the original developer of the codebase(s) for this bot and will be leading the project. Potential candidates must be available for a voice chat technical interview to assess their skills. If you do not possess the required skills please do not apply (I will be able to tell if you are lying).
Payment will probably be hourly rather than a lump sum. The Budget below is just an estimate and required for laborX